Academic Year Total Enrollment Undergraduate Percentage Key Notes 2018-2019 ~51,000 ~75% Record-setting applications 2021-2022 ~52,000 ~77% Recovery period post-pandemic 2023-2024 ~53,000 ~76% Continued growth and diversification.
